What is DVA Community Nursing?
DVA Community Nursing Services provide clinically necessary nursing care to veterans who need health support at home. The program helps you maintain independence, prevent hospital admissions, and manage ongoing medical or personal care needs.
These services are funded by DVA for people who hold eligible veteran cards. Not sure if you eligible? Learn about Veteran Card benefits and eligibility.
Our DVA Nursing Services
Our qualified nurses provide safe, professional, and respectful care tailored to your health needs.
We can support you with:
- Wound care (simple and complex wound management)
- Personal care
- Medication administration and management
- Diabetes monitoring
- Post-operative (post-op) care
- IDC/SPC catheter care
- Stoma care
- Continence care
- Continence assessments
- Palliative nursing care
- Chronic disease monitoring
- Hospital discharge follow-up
